S. E. C. v. EQUITY SERVICE CORP.

No. 80-1273.

632 F.2d 1092 (1980)

SECURITIES AND EXCHANGE COMMISSION, v. EQUITY SERVICE CORP., Leverage Resources Corp., Pacific-Atlantic Oil Co., Inc., Robert H. Mortimer, Virginia Joan Mortimer, Fred Fleischman, Robert F. Abramson, James P. Spillers (James P. Madison) Respondents, Porter Jerry, Dollie Mae Martin Jerry, Betty Lou Gregory and Lillie Gregory, Appellants, Frank Concannon, Receiver, Appellee.

United States Court of Appeals, Third Circuit.

Decided October 20, 1980.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Thomas B. Rutter, Philadelphia, Pa., Bobby E. Shepherd, Spencer, Spencer & Shepherd, El Dorado, Ark., for appellants.

Dennis R. Surprenant, Securities and Exchange Commission, Philadelphia, Pa., Linda D. Fienberg, Michael K. Wolensky, Securities and Exchange Commission, Washington, D. C., Melvin Lashner, Philadelphia, Pa., for appellee; Adelman & Lavine, Philadelphia, Pa., of counsel.

Before SEITZ, Chief Judge, HIGGINBOTHAM, Circuit Judge, and MEANOR, District Judge.


Submitted under Third Circuit Rule 12(6) October 10, 1980.

OPINION OF THE COURT

PER CURIAM:

Appellants, Porter Jerry, Dollie Mae Martin Jerry, Betty Lou Gregory, and Lillie Gregory, appeal from an order of the district court enjoining them from bringing their lease-cancellation claim against a federal receiver, Frank Concannon, in the Arkansas Chancery Court.
